This paper describes our on-going efforts to develop an Augmented Reality system for enhanced pilot situational awareness in airport runways and taxiways. The system consists of a sensing component based on computer vision and an information component based on high-fidelity graphic model databases. Vision algorithms are used for a variety of guidance and warning tasks. A necessary requirement is for vision algorithms to have a real-time response.
